服务器中HA指的是什么

不及物动词 其他 20

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    HA是服务器中的一个术语,指的是高可用性(High Availability)。

    服务器是一个关键的基础设施,为用户提供各种服务。然而,服务器系统也会遇到各种故障,如硬件故障、网络中断、操作系统崩溃等。这些故障会导致服务中断,给用户带来不便和损失。为了避免这种情况,需要在服务器架构中引入HA机制。

    HA是通过提供冗余和故障转移的方式来实现高可用性。具体来说,HA的实施通常会采取以下几个方面的措施:

    1. 硬件冗余:在服务器系统中引入冗余组件,如双电源、双网卡、RAID阵列等,以防止单点故障的发生。

    2. 软件冗余:利用集群技术,将多个服务器组合成一个逻辑单元,共同提供服务。当其中一个服务器故障时,其他服务器能够接管其功能,保证服务的连续性。

    3. 心跳检测:通过心跳检测机制,服务器之间相互监控,确保系统正常运行。一旦发现其他服务器故障,及时进行故障转移。

    4. 备份和恢复:定期对服务器中的数据进行备份,并建立备份服务器。当主服务器发生故障时,可以将备份数据恢复到备份服务器上,尽快恢复服务。

    5. 负载均衡:通过将请求分发到多个服务器上,均衡服务器的负载,避免单个服务器被过度请求,提高整体性能和可靠性。

    通过以上措施的组合应用,可以大幅提高服务器的可用性和可靠性。当服务器发生故障时,HA机制能够快速检测、转移和恢复,保证服务的连续性和稳定性。因此,HA是服务器中重要的概念,广泛应用于各种服务环境中。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在服务器环境中,HA(High Availability)指的是一种技术或解决方案,旨在确保系统或服务始终保持高可用性和可靠性。HA主要通过冗余和故障转移来实现,以防止单点故障导致系统中断或服务不可用的情况。

    下面是解释HA的几个关键点:

    1. 冗余:HA通过创建冗余的服务器或组件来保障系统的可用性。例如,在一个HA集群中,多个服务器可能具有相同的功能和功能,并且能够共享负载。当其中一个服务器发生故障时,其他服务器可以接管并继续提供服务,确保系统的连续性。

    2. 故障转移:故障转移是HA的核心概念之一。当主服务器发生故障时,HA解决方案能够快速自动地将工作负载转移到备用服务器上,以保证服务的持续性。故障转移通常使用技术(如热备份、冷备份、故障探测和自动切换等)来实现。

    3. 设备健康监测:HA需要对服务器或组件的健康状况进行监测,以及时发现任何潜在的故障或问题。例如,可以通过监测服务器的负载、网络状况、存储容量等指标来判断其健康状态。如果发现任何异常情况,HA解决方案将根据设定的策略自动进行故障转移。

    4. 负载均衡:HA还涉及到负载均衡的概念,以确保各服务器之间的工作负载均匀分配。负载均衡可以通过将请求分发到不同的服务器上,以使服务器的负载分散,并提高整体的性能和可用性。

    5. 高可用性:HA的最终目标是提供高可用性的服务。这意味着系统或服务在面对各种故障或问题时能够保持不间断的运行。通过使用HA技术,可以最大限度地减少服务中断时间,提供可靠和稳定的服务给用户。

    总结来说,服务器中的HA指的是一种技术和解决方案,旨在确保系统或服务的高可用性。通过冗余、故障转移、设备健康监测、负载均衡等手段,HA可以提供具有弹性和可靠性的服务器环境,使系统在面对故障时能够保持不间断的运行。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在服务器中,HA指的是高可用性(High Availability)。高可用性是指系统或服务能够长时间持续运行,几乎没有中断或停机时间的能力。实现高可用性的目的是确保业务连续性,避免因系统故障或其他意外事件而导致的业务中断或损失。

    实现服务器的高可用性可以通过以下几种方式:

    1. 冗余:通过将服务器的关键组件进行冗余配置,如双电源、双网卡、双硬盘等,以确保即使一个组件发生故障,系统仍然可以继续运行。冗余配置可以通过硬件冗余(如使用双机热备份)或软件冗余(如使用虚拟化技术)来实现。

    2. 负载均衡:通过将流量分发到多个服务器上,以平衡每台服务器的负载,提高整体性能和可用性。常见的负载均衡方式包括基于硬件的负载均衡器和基于软件的负载均衡器。

    3. 故障检测与恢复:通过实时监控服务器的状态,一旦发现故障,及时进行故障检测和恢复操作。常见的故障检测与恢复技术包括心跳检测、故障转移、故障恢复等。

    4. 数据备份与恢复:定期对服务器的数据进行备份,以防止数据丢失。同时,备份数据还可以用于系统恢复,以降低系统故障对业务的影响。

    5. 容错设计:采用容错设计的服务器可以在发生故障时自动切换到备用的系统上,以实现业务的持续运行。常见的容错设计技术包括热备份、热切换、双机热备等。

    综上所述,通过冗余、负载均衡、故障检测与恢复、数据备份与恢复以及容错设计等方式,可以实现服务器的高可用性,确保业务的连续性和稳定性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部